Hydroxypropyl methylcellulose is characterized by its unique structure in which hydroxypropyl and methyl groups are chemically linked to the cellulose backbone. This modification enhances its solubility in water and provides several desirable properties for its applications in the pharmaceutical and dietary supplement industries.
